SANTA BARBARA, CA June 14, 2007—The Aspen Institute’s Henry Crown Fellowship Program today announced its 2007 Class of Henry Crown Fellows.

The Henry Crown Fellowship is designed to engage the next generation of leaders in the challenge of community spirited leadership. It brings together entrepreneurial young executives and professionals under age 45 who have already achieved conspicuous success in their chosen fields of endeavor. The new Henry Crown Fellows will meet four times over a two-year period and will undertake individual community service commitments.

The Henry Crown Fellows for 2007 are:

“We are delighted with this year’s class of Henry Crown Fellows”, said Peter Reiling, Executive Director of the program. “For society, they represent a potent force of talent, ready to focus their energies on some of the greatest challenges of our times. For them, they are embarking on a personal journey —a journey ‘from success to significance’—that will change their lives forever. I know. I’m a Henry Crown Fellow too.”

The Henry Crown Fellowship Program was established in 1997 to honor the life and career of Chicago industrialist Henry Crown (1896-1990) and was initially funded by the Henry and Gladys Crown Charitable Trust Fund.

The Aspen Institute is an international non-profit organization founded in 1950. Its mission is to foster enlightened leadership, the appreciation of timeless ideas and values, and open-minded dialogue on contemporary issues. The Henry Crown Fellowship Program is a member of the Aspen Global Leadership Network, currently spanning 26 countries.
